Today, Wednesday, May 27, 2026, features a high-stakes Eliminator match between Sunrisers Hyderabad (SRH) and Rajasthan Royals (RR) in the IPL 2026 playoffs.
Following the conclusion of Qualifier 1, where Royal Challengers Bengaluru (RCB) secured their spot in the final by defeating the Gujarat Titans (GT), the focus shifts to this knockout encounter.
TL;DR: The Stakes
The equation is brutal and simple: win or go home. The winner of tonight’s clash in New Chandigarh punches their ticket to face Gujarat Titans in Qualifier 2 on May 29, keeping their dreams of a Grand Final against RCB alive. For the loser, a grueling two-month campaign ends tonight.

Team Standings and Path to the Eliminator
- Sunrisers Hyderabad (SRH): Finished the league stage in 3rd place with 18 points (9 wins, 5 losses) and a net run rate (NRR) of +0.524.
- Rajasthan Royals (RR): Finished in 4th place with 16 points (8 wins, 6 losses) and an NRR of +0.189.
- Recent Form: SRH enters with a record of two wins in their last five games (W-W-L-W-L), while RR has struggled recently, securing only one win in their last four matches (W-L-L-L-W).
Tactical Crux: The Key Matchups
1. SRH’s Powerplay Blitz vs RR’s Powerplay Discipline
The narrative of SRH’s season has been their explosive, boundary-heavy approach in the first six overs. However, RR boasts one of the most disciplined new-ball attacks in the tournament.
The Battle: Can SRH’s top order disrupt RR’s lines early, or will RR’s seamers choke the run rate and force rash shots?
2. The Spin Throttle in the Middle Overs
The middle phase (Overs 7–15) will likely decide the momentum. RR relies heavily on their spin twins to constrict batsmen and pick up crucial wickets when the field spreads. SRH’s middle order will need to show immense tactical maturity to avoid a mid-innings collapse.
Pitch and Weather Conditions
The Surface
Unlike the absolute highway seen in Dharamsala during Qualifier 1, the track at New Chandigarh offers a more balanced contest.
Early Assistance: Seamers can expect some true bounce and subtle movement under lights during the initial overs.
The Dew Factor: As the evening progresses, dew is expected to play a significant role. Winning the toss and opting to field first will likely be the preferred strategy to avoid handling a wet ball in the second innings.
Weather
Clear skies with temperatures hovering around 30°C at night. Humidity will rise as the match progresses, increasing the likelihood of heavy dew.

Head-to-Head Stats for the Article:
Total Meetings: 21 matches
SRH Wins: 13
RR Wins: 8
2026 Season Performance: SRH won both league stage encounters against RR this season, giving them a psychological edge heading into tonight’s knockout.
